The Art of Real Estate in Tucson

Placement, Price, and Percetion are three factors when selling your home.  If you are looking to make your next move, consider the following:

 

PLACEMENT – Is your home placed in an area that will brng a certain group of buyers?  You may need to re-evaluate your community.  Communities change throughout the years.  Family neighborhoods can turn into retirement neighborhoods and vis versa.  Families traditionally move between school breaks.  If you neighborhood attracts a leisurely lifestyle, consider placing your home on the market in late summer when people are starting to think about coming to the southwest.

 

PRICE – Price your house to sell.  When a house stays on the market too long, you loose your enthusiasm for your house and it will show when buyers walk through.    With the changes in the Appraisal Data Set in September, 2011,  you will be given points for the updated kitchen, larger lot, vast views, and more.  I guess what I am saying is don’t price your house too low and base it on the short sales and foreclosures in the area.

 

PERCEPTION:  This is about changing the way people see things in your home, shifting attitudes, and gaining recognition for what you have.  When homes are streamlines with no clutter, minimal memorabilia, the house provides a safe haven for the buyer to look around and feel at home.   Make your countertops, flooring, walls, and baseboards immaculate.  Immaculate homes provide the buyer an understanding that the home was well taken care of.

 

Real Estate Word of the Month:  SITUS

The personal preference of people for one area over another, not necessarily based on objective facts and knowledge.
